Why Choose a 40 ft Shipping Container for Your Needs in Kenya?

The 40 ft shipping container is a powerhouse of utility. Measuring approximately 12.19m (L) x 2.44m (W) x 2.59m (H) externally for a standard unit, it offers significant cubic capacity, making it ideal for a multitude of applications across Kenya:

  • Extensive Storage Solutions: Perfect for warehousing large quantities of goods, equipment, or inventory for businesses in Nairobi, Kisumu, or Eldoret.
  • Robust & Secure Transport: Essential for international logistics and domestic cargo movement, ensuring goods arrive safely.
  • Foundation for Conversions: The ample space makes it a popular choice for transforming into container homes, site offices, retail shops, clinics, or student accommodation in various Kenyan towns. Ideal Containers excels in these custom fabrications.
  • Cost-Effective Alternative: Compared to traditional brick-and-mortar construction, a 40 ft container offers a quicker, more economical, and versatile solution.

Key Factors Influencing Your 40 ft Shipping Container Cost

Understanding these variables is crucial when requesting a quote from Ideal Containers:

  1. New vs. Used 40 ft Containers

    The choice between a new and used container is perhaps the most significant determinant of the initial 40 ft shipping container cost.

    • New Containers (One-Trip): These are factory-fresh, ISO-certified containers used only once to transport cargo from the manufacturing country to Kenya. They are in pristine condition, offering maximum longevity and aesthetic appeal. Naturally, their price point is higher, reflecting their superior quality and minimal wear. They are ideal for high-end conversions or long-term secure storage where appearance and durability are paramount.
    • Used Containers: Ideal Containers offers cost-effective, pre-owned containers in good condition. These are typically categorized by their structural integrity:
      • Cargo Worthy (CW): Structurally sound, wind and watertight, and suitable for shipping cargo internationally. They represent a good balance of cost and functionality.
      • Wind and Watertight (WWT): Guaranteed to keep the elements out, perfect for secure ground storage. While they may have cosmetic dents or rust, their functionality is uncompromised. This is often the most economical choice for storage in places like Kisii or Mandera.

      The condition of a used container directly correlates with its 40 ft shipping container cost, with WWT being more affordable than CW.

  2. Type of 40 ft Container

    Beyond standard dry vans, specialized 40 ft containers carry different price tags due to their unique features and construction:

    • Standard 40 ft Dry Van: This is the most common and generally the baseline for the 40 ft shipping container cost. It’s suitable for general dry cargo and a wide range of conversions.
    • 40 ft High Cube Container: With an external height of approximately 2.89m, this offers an extra foot of vertical space compared to a standard container. This added height significantly increases the internal volume (around 68-70m³) and is highly sought after for conversions into homes, offices, or workshops in areas like Nairobi where space is premium, thus increasing its cost slightly.
    • 40 ft Reefer (Refrigerated) Container: These specialized units come with advanced refrigeration systems capable of maintaining temperatures between -30°C to +30°C. Ideal Containers offers 40ft reefer containers with internal dimensions of 11.56m (L) x 2.29m (W) x 2.25m (H) and a volume of ~58–60m³. Their complex machinery, insulation, and 3-phase electrical requirements mean their 40 ft shipping container cost is substantially higher than dry vans. They are crucial for transporting or storing perishable goods, pharmaceuticals, or sensitive materials across Kenya, including to warmer regions like Lodwar.
    • Specialized Options: Open-top, flat-rack, or tank containers are available for niche applications and will have different pricing structures based on their unique build and limited availability.
  3. Modifications and Customizations

    If you plan to convert your 40 ft container, the extent of modifications will significantly impact the overall 40 ft shipping container cost. Ideal Containers excels in transforming standard containers into bespoke solutions. Features like:

    • Custom window and door installations
    • Full insulation for temperature control
    • Electrical wiring, lighting, and plumbing systems
    • HVAC (heating, ventilation, air conditioning)
    • Interior finishing (flooring, walls, ceilings)
    • Partitioning, shelving, and built-in furniture
    • Exterior paint, branding, and security features

    Each added feature contributes to the final project cost, turning a simple container into a fully functional and comfortable space for your specific needs in any part of Kenya.

  4. Delivery and Logistics

    The cost of transporting a 40 ft container from Ideal Containers’ facility in Nairobi to your specific location in Kenya is an important component of the total 40 ft shipping container cost. Factors include:

    • Distance: Longer distances to cities like Mombasa, Kisumu, Eldoret, or Mandera will incur higher transport fees.
    • Accessibility: Difficulty in accessing the site, road conditions, and the need for specialized transport vehicles can affect pricing.
    • Offloading: The cost of hiring a crane or specialized equipment for offloading and positioning the 40 ft container at your site.
  5. Market Demand and Currency Fluctuations

    The price of shipping containers, especially used ones, can fluctuate based on global supply and demand, as well as exchange rates against the Kenyan Shilling. Ideal Containers strives to offer competitive market rates, providing value for money.

  6. Additional Features and Accessories

    Items like heavy-duty locking mechanisms, security bars, ventilation systems, or specific fixtures can add to the total 40 ft shipping container cost but enhance the container’s functionality and security, particularly for high-value storage in urban centers like Nakuru or remote sites in Taita.

Beyond the Purchase Price: Essential Additional Costs for Your 40 ft Container Project

When budgeting for your 40 ft container, it’s vital to look beyond the initial purchase or rental price. Several other expenses can factor into the overall project cost:

  • Site Preparation: Preparing a level and stable foundation is crucial for the longevity and safety of your 40 ft container. This might involve grading, laying concrete slabs, or installing footings.
  • Permits and Regulations: Depending on the local council in areas like Kajiado or Uasin Gishu and the intended use (especially for permanent structures or commercial operations), you may need to obtain building permits or adhere to specific regulations.
  • Utility Connections: For converted containers, connecting to electricity, water, and sewage lines will be an additional expense, involving plumbers and electricians.
  • Maintenance: While containers are low-maintenance, occasional checks for rust, paint touch-ups, and door seal integrity will ensure its lifespan, especially in varying Kenyan climates.

Renting a 40 ft Shipping Container: An Alternative Solution for Your Budget

Purchasing a 40 ft container isn’t always the most suitable option, especially for temporary needs. Ideal Containers offers flexible container hire/rental services, including 40 ft containers, with a minimum 3-month rental period. This can be a significantly more cost-effective solution in certain scenarios:

  • Temporary Site Accommodation: Ideal for construction projects in Machakos or Taita where an office or storage unit is only needed for a defined period.
  • Event Storage: Perfect for secure storage at festivals or large gatherings in Kisumu or Nakuru.
  • Pop-Up Retail Spaces: For businesses testing new markets or seasonal operations.
  • Emergency or Seasonal Storage: When extra space is required quickly without the commitment of purchase.

The rental 40 ft shipping container cost will vary based on the duration of the lease and the container type, offering financial flexibility for businesses and individuals throughout Kenya.
